Week 1: The paradox that intrigued me the most was Strategic and Administrative. I was interested in seeking out more information because I loathe having to spend time doing tasks that, while they are necessary, take time away from my ability to be a strategic business partner. On the other hand, too much technology can take away from the "human" in human resources. It's up to the HR professional to determine what processes should be completed via technology and what shouldn't. Most organizations utilize some type of Human Resource Information System, and it's essential to recognize the cost-benefit. "The Human Resources Information System brings many benefits to the department related to data integration, accuracy, benefits management, recruitment management, but it may also have some disadvantages such as security, cost and the need for an IT specialist to manage the system (Bruce, 2014).
